OM617 Injection pump questions

So this weekend I pulled out my prechambers and replaced them with brand new clean ones. The lock collars on top have been leaking for quite some time after they were tightened in hopes of fixing it lol. In the process I noted that two of the injectors (4&5) were out of a 240d. Having spare housings and internals for 300sd injectors I cleaned and replaced everything but the lower cases as they were identical. However my car will not start acts like it almost will and when I tested the injectors out of the engine. I couldn't get the first one to pop. When I tried it on another line it popped just fine. Could my injection pump be bad...or is this a case of injectors needing balanced? Any thoughts on this greatly appreciated. Also to note it was starting fine in 22 degree weather three days before and fired right up the morning before but now it's so so close just never quite fires all the ways
